    Hi Guys,

    Following on from my review of this piece from Stu Hale's emporium of resin thought I would start this thread.

    I always put the work onto its final base and then wrap in cling film and in low tack paper tape(the model not me!!!!!)
    R1.jpg
    Once I had prepped the figure up I primed in black as is my chosen choice .......all work in Acrylics for me .

    Base coats were applied using mainly GW paints with some from the Army Painter.
    R2.jpg
    The face will be first ...base coat applied using mixes ...I did this several times as I wasn't happy ...inbetween this I also built up the beard a bit ....more work on the face ..now looks different !!!
    R3.jpg R4.jpg R5.jpg
    Then it was the waistcoat various reds were on the bench ...once I was happy with that .....deep breathing was the order of the day ...

    ...the lacework ..there is lot of it!...NMM for me using a Snakebite leather , black and white for the shadows and highs .......where we are is about 6 hours of holding my breath ...I don't work fast !.....still going to go back to this once the collar lace is done .
    R6.jpg R7.jpg
    ...time to stop swearing and realise I am enjoying this immensely

    More to follow(in between painting something less lacey!!!)....the plan is to have this finished for FW...honest!!!
